Maton MS500HC
"Maton's Patrick Evans shows off the MS500/HC, which has the Australian company's own MVB1 and MVS1 pickups and a gearshift-style tone knob with settings labeled as ""Cool,"" ""Midway"" and ""Hi-Fi."" "

The first entry in Friedman Amplification’s much-anticipated Vintage Collection is the Plex, a painstakingly crafted homage to Dave Friedman’s own 1968 JMP Super Lead plexi—the archetype and foundation on which the entireFriedman lineup is based.

When he’s on the West Coast, Jim Campilongo feels something like a stranger in his own home. His latest record pays tribute to the city he misses when he’s there, and the one where he built most of his career.

Photo by Joe Ferrucci

The San Francisco-born roots-rock guitarist feels like an East Coaster at heart, and his latest, She Loved the Coney Island Freak Show, might be his most rocking, fitting homage to the Big Apple.

When Jim Campilongo phones in with Premier Guitar, it’s from his home in the Bay Area—the same place where he first picked up the guitar in the 1970s, began playing shows with local groups some years later and, eventually, launched his recording career in the 1990s. Over the subsequent decades, he established himself as one of the instrument’s foremost creatives, building a catalog of primarily instrumental albums that encompass a dazzling array of styles—rock, jazz, roots, Western swing, classical, experimental—all informed by his inventive, flexible and never-predictable playing, mostly on a Fender Telecaster plugged direct into an amp.
